Subject: [PATCH] crypto: scompress - don't sleep with preemption disabled
Git-commit: 3c08377262880afc1621ab9cb6dbe7df47a6033d
Patch-mainline: v4.14-rc1
References: bsc#1051510

Due to the use of per-CPU buffers, scomp_acomp_comp_decomp() executes
with preemption disabled, and so whether the CRYPTO_TFM_REQ_MAY_SLEEP
flag is set is irrelevant, since we cannot sleep anyway. So disregard
the flag, and use GFP_ATOMIC unconditionally.
